Abstract

Reaction mother liquor of terephthalic acid production is treated to separate volatile component mainly composed of acetic acid and solid components composed of used catalyst or heavy metal salt(s), residual terephthalic acid and reaction by-products by using combination of a tubular type heater having at least one heating tube of a relatively small diameter and a separation chamber in which the heating tube(s) open(s) at one end thereof.
